"Running around naked and worshiping trees" is obviously a reference to the celts who were reported to occasionally enter battle naked and revered the oak tree. The Kingdom of Funan in Cambodia actually arose a few decades after the Gallic wars ended this era in modern day France and about the same time as the Roman invasion of Britain, arguably technological changes had already begun to take place in the decades before this so I am not sure whether your statement is all that accurate.

There would be another wave of economic change across the rest of Europe, extending as far as Russia, from the time of Charlemagne onwards which introduced the heavy plow and 3 field crop rotation. By the 12th century cathedrals were being built that arguably rivalled Angkor Wat in sophistication and grandeur.

Regardless, this is a valid question, from our perspective the wide fields of Europe seem much more hospitable than the jungles of South East Asia. However perceptions can be deceiving, were you to travel back in time, the land surrounding Angkor Wat would also be as intensively farmed.

http://www.livescience.com/1781-urban-sprawl-doomed-angkor-wat.html

Because they existed in very different environments it is impossible to judge which collective population group "accomplished more" and I don't particularly care. The individuals responsible for advancing agriculture in these regions were surely exceptional people though.

Southeast Asia is one of the most underrated areas of the world historically. It's barely taught in world history classes and in many cases does not merit its own course in universities. It's glossed over to a ridiculous extent despite the high demand for spices and other trade items from the region for centuries. In terms of civilization, there were complex, populous and technologically advanced societies with incredible political histories. The histories of Java, Vietnam, Cambodia, Thailand and Burma are filled with ambition, decline, civil war, shifting geopolitical borders, diverse peoples, migrations, conquests and archaeological wonders yet many of those countries treated like a footnote. In other cases the region is treated like an appendage of India and China which contributed nothing on its own.

It's not even really my main field of interest but I find it annoying how ignored the region is and how little people care about it. This might sound trite but Southeast Asia is not like vast swathes of Subsaharan Africa or Aboriginal Australia where hardly anything worthwhile was going on. There really was a lot happening in this region and it really had a big impact on world history or at least regional (East Asian) history in premodern times.

Eh...Singapore is more of an exception rather than the rule, and actually it kinda tells a lot about the region in its current state. The tiniest country in Southeast Asia is the most powerful economically and most significant globally. Granted any power that controlled the major port on the Sunda or Malacca Straits historically was a guaranteed powerhouse and I suppose Singapore is sort of the heir to that tradition.

Admittedly Vietnam, the Philippines and Indonesia are coming along but Myanmar still has a long way to go. Brunei has the economic prowess but lacks diversification and is totally backwards under their laughable government. Thailand is somewhere in the middle while the rest are developing but also still have a long way to go.

I agree that there is a lot of potential in the region but I can see why it is kind of looked down upon as a backwater today. I feel like they are particularly underrated historically though given their long historical record of civilization and overall significance.
